Erlang B calculations are a crucial component of telecom network planning, and mastering them can help you ensure that your cellular infrastructure is both robust and reliable. We'll provide step-by-step guidance, real-world examples, and practical insights into how Erlang B can be used to determine the capacity of a cell, making it an indispensable tool in network design.
